Guwahati: A convoy of BTR chief Pramod Boro’s was involved in an accident last night in which one policeman was killed and three others were injured.

According to sources, the convoy was being diverted from Tamulpur and the accident took place in the 11th mile of Rangia.
Although nothing happened to Pramod Boro or his vehicle, an escort vehicle lost control and fell into a ditch.

An officer in the car, identified as Raju Kalita, died in the crash.

Three others, identified as Brojen Rajbongshi, Utpal Patgiri and Prakash Boro, were critically injured.

He has been shifted to a medical center for treatment but his condition remains critical.

No civilians were injured in the crash.
